The Broadlands

   

Home to the 1999 Parade of Homes, The Broadlands is a well-designed and thought-out master-planned Colorado golf community. With multiple parks, lots of open space, trails and a great golf course meandering through the middle, it is not hard to see why this area has blossomed since development first began.  

Real estate in the area varies in types of homes and prices, but goes up to and around the two million dollar mark. The Broadlands is a collection of several unique and distinct enclaves surrounding the golf club. A unique perk of one of the neighborhoods (fairway oaks) in The Broadlands area is that it is one of only a few Colorado golf communities to allow resident owned golf carts on the course. 

Central to Boulder and Denver, Broomfield enjoys good access to highways making it a popular location for commuters to either Denver or Boulder. The completion of the North West Parkway has created a welcome connector that makes for an easier commute to Denver International Airport.   

The city and county of Broomfield has many appealing qualities that have helped to make it a popular location. Residents can enjoy miles of trails, lots of parks, acres of open space, not to mention the relatively short drive to the mountains.  The Broomfield Events Center completed in 2006 is home to the Colorado 14er’s (basketball) and the Rocky Mountain Rage (hockey) sports teams and hosts special events, concerts and conventions.  

The Broadlands name implies broad, open fairways and the course lives up to the name as it meanders through the neighborhoods.
